SQL: യുഎസിനും കാനഡയ്ക്കുമായുള്ള സംസ്ഥാനങ്ങൾക്കും പ്രവിശ്യകൾക്കുമായുള്ള പൂർണ്ണ നാമം തിരയൽ
ഈ വാരാന്ത്യത്തിൽ ഒരു Google മാപ്പിംഗ് പ്രോജക്റ്റിൽ പ്രവർത്തിക്കുമ്പോൾ, എനിക്ക് ഒരു പട്ടിക തയ്യാറാക്കേണ്ടതുണ്ട് MySQL അത് 2-അക്ക രാജ്യത്തെയും സംസ്ഥാന ചുരുക്കങ്ങളെയും ഒരു പൂർണ്ണ നാമത്തിലേക്ക് വിവർത്തനം ചെയ്തു. ഇത് അൽപ്പം ആവശ്യമുള്ള ഒന്നാണെന്ന് എനിക്ക് ഉറപ്പുണ്ട്, അതിനാൽ ഡ SQL ൺലോഡിനായി ഞാൻ SQL ഫയൽ എന്റെ സെർവറിൽ സ്ഥാപിച്ചു.
യുണൈറ്റഡ് സ്റ്റേറ്റ്സിനും കാനഡയ്ക്കുമായുള്ള സംസ്ഥാന, പ്രവിശ്യ ചുരുക്കങ്ങൾക്കായുള്ള SQL പ്രസ്താവന ഇതാ. പ്രകടനം മെച്ചപ്പെടുത്തുന്നതിനായി ഞാൻ രാജ്യത്തെയും സംസ്ഥാന ഐഡികളെയും കുറിച്ച് ഒരു സൂചിക ചേർത്തു.
പട്ടിക സൃഷ്ടിക്കുക `(` COUNTRYID` varchar (2) NULL, `STATEID` varchar (2) NULL,` FULLNAME` varchar (30) NULL, KEY `country` (` COUNTRYID`), KEY ʻid` (`STATEID`)) ENGINE = MyISAM DEFAULT CHARSET = utf8 COMMENT = 'യുഎസിനും കാനഡയ്ക്കുമായി സംസ്ഥാനവും പ്രവിശ്യയും പൂർണ്ണ നാമം തിരയൽ';
`സംസ്ഥാനങ്ങളിൽ '(` COUNTRYID`, `STATEID`,` FULLNAME`) മൂല്യങ്ങൾ (' CA ',' AB ',' ആൽബർട്ട '), (' CA ',' BC ',' ബ്രിട്ടീഷ് കൊളംബിയ '), (' സിഎ ',' എംബി ',' മാനിറ്റോബ '), (' സിഎ ',' എൻബി ',' ന്യൂ ബ്രൺസ്വിക്ക് '), (' സിഎ ',' എൻഎൽ ',' ന്യൂഫ ound ണ്ട് ലാൻഡ്, ലാബ്രഡോർ '), (' സിഎ ',' എൻഎസ് ',' നോവ സ്കോട്ടിയ '), (' സിഎ ',' എൻടി ',' വടക്കുപടിഞ്ഞാറൻ പ്രവിശ്യകൾ '), (' സിഎ ',' എൻയു ',' നുനാവത്ത് '), (' സിഎ ',' ഓൺ ',' ഒന്റാറിയോ ') , ('സിഎ', 'പിഇ', 'പ്രിൻസ് എഡ്വേർഡ് ഐലന്റ്'), ('സിഎ', 'ക്യുസി', 'ക്യൂബെക്ക്'), ('സിഎ', 'എസ്കെ', 'സസ്കറ്റാചെവൻ'), ('സിഎ', 'YT', 'Yukon'), ('US', 'AK', 'Alaska'), ('US', 'AL', 'Alabama'), ('US', 'AR', 'Arkansas') , ('യുഎസ്', 'എസെഡ്', 'അരിസോണ'), ('യുഎസ്', 'സിഎ', 'കാലിഫോർണിയ'), ('യുഎസ്', 'സിഒ', 'കൊളറാഡോ'), ('യുഎസ്', 'സി.ടി. ',' കണക്റ്റിക്കട്ട് '), (' യുഎസ് ',' ഡിസി ',' ഡിസ്ട്രിക്റ്റ് ഓഫ് കൊളംബിയ '), (' യുഎസ് ',' ഡി.ഇ ',' ഡെലവെയർ '), (' യുഎസ് ',' എഫ്.എൽ ',' ഫ്ലോറിഡ ') , ('യുഎസ്', 'ജിഎ', 'ജോർജിയ'), ('യുഎസ്', 'എച്ച്ഐ', 'ഹവായ്'), ('യുഎസ്', 'ഐഎ', 'അയോവ'), ('യുഎസ്', 'ഐഡി ',' ഐഡഹോ '), (' യുഎസ് ',' ഐഎൽ ',' ഇല്ലിനോയിസ് '), (' യുഎസ് ',' ഐഎൻ ',' ഇന്ത്യാന '), (' യുഎസ് ',' കെ.എസ് ',' കൻസാസ് '), ( 'യുഎസ്', 'കെവൈ', 'കെന്റക്കി'), ('യുഎസ്', 'എൽഎ', 'ലൂസിയാന'), ('യുഎസ്', 'എംഎ', 'മസാച്ചുസെറ്റ്സ്'), ('യുഎസ്', 'എംഡി', 'മാർ yland '), (' യുഎസ് ',' എംഇ ',' മെയ്ൻ '), (' യുഎസ് ',' എംഐ ',' മിഷിഗൺ '), (' യുഎസ് ',' എംഎൻ ',' മിനസോട്ട '), (' യുഎസ് ' , 'MO', 'മിസോറി'), ('യുഎസ്', 'എം.എസ്', 'മിസിസിപ്പി'), ('യുഎസ്', 'എം.ടി', 'മൊണ്ടാന'), ('യുഎസ്', 'എൻസി', 'നോർത്ത് കരോലിന '), (' യുഎസ് ',' എൻഡി ',' നോർത്ത് ഡക്കോട്ട '), (' യുഎസ് ',' എൻഇ ',' നെബ്രാസ്ക '), (' യുഎസ് ',' എൻഎച്ച് ',' ന്യൂ ഹാംഷെയർ '), (' യുഎസ് ',' എൻജെ ',' ന്യൂജേഴ്സി '), (' യുഎസ് ',' എൻഎം ',' ന്യൂ മെക്സിക്കോ '), (' യുഎസ് ',' എൻവി ',' നെവാഡ '), (' യുഎസ് ',' എൻവൈ ', 'ന്യൂയോർക്ക്'), ('യുഎസ്', 'ഒ.എച്ച്', 'ഒഹായോ'), ('യുഎസ്', 'ഓകെ', 'ഒക്ലഹോമ'), ('യുഎസ്', 'അല്ലെങ്കിൽ', 'ഒറിഗോൺ'), (' യുഎസ് ',' പിഎ ',' പെൻസിൽവാനിയ '), (' യുഎസ് ',' ആർഐ ',' റോഡ് ഐലൻഡ് '), (' യുഎസ് ',' എസ്സി ',' സൗത്ത് കരോലിന '), (' യുഎസ് ',' എസ്ഡി ' , 'സൗത്ത് ഡക്കോട്ട'), ('യുഎസ്', 'ടിഎൻ', 'ടെന്നസി'), ('യുഎസ്', 'ടിഎക്സ്', 'ടെക്സസ്'), ('യുഎസ്', 'യുടി', 'യൂട്ടാ'), ( 'യുഎസ്', 'വിഎ', 'വിർജീനിയ'), ('യുഎസ്', 'ആറാമൻ,' വിർജിൻ ദ്വീപുകൾ '), (' യുഎസ് ',' വിടി ',' വെർമോണ്ട് '), (' യുഎസ് ',' ഡബ്ല്യുഎ ' , 'വാഷിംഗ്ടൺ'), ('യുഎസ്', 'ഡബ്ല്യു.ഐ', 'വിസ്കോൺസിൻ'), ('യുഎസ്', 'ഡബ്ല്യു.വി', 'വെസ്റ്റ് വെർജീനിയ'), ('യുഎസ്', 'ഡബ്ല്യു.വൈ', 'വ്യോമിംഗ്');
തൊപ്പി ടിപ്പ് നല്ല സിഎസ്വി ഉണ്ടായിരുന്ന ബ്രയാൻ എനിക്ക് ജോലി ചെയ്യാൻ കഴിഞ്ഞു.